Mathematical Aspects of Evolving Interfaces Lectures given at the C.I.M.-C.I.M.E. joint Euro-Summer School held in Madeira Funchal, Portugal, July 3-9, 2000 / by Luigi Ambrosio, Klaus Deckelnick, Gerhard Dziuk, Masayasu Mimura, Vsvolod Solonnikov, Halil Mete Soner ; edited by Pierluigi Colli.

Interfaces are geometrical objects modelling free or moving boundaries and arise in a wide range of phase change problems in physical and biological sciences, particularly in material technology and in dynamics of patterns.
